Eeffect of nitric oxide on the expression of long type of leptin receptor in dorsal root ganglion

Abstract: Objective To investigate the effect of nitric oxide (NO) on the expression of long type of leptin receptor (OB-Rb) in dorsal root ganglion (DRG) neurons cultured in vitro. Methods Sodium nitroprusside (SNP; 0, 0.01, 0.1 and 0.5 mmol/L) were used to treat the DRG neurons cultured in vitro. RT-PCR and Western Blot were used to detect the expression of long types of leptin receptor (OB-Rb) in DRG neurons. Results 0.1~0.5 mmol/L SNP can increase the expression of OB-Rb mRNA and protein Conclusion The modulation of NO on DRG neurons may be relative with the action of leptin.
